SIMON PARK…
Simon began his yoga journey in 1995 with Shiva Rea at UCLA and has since become a globally recognized teacher. Named “one of the most influential yoga teachers of the next generation” by Yoga Journal, he’s led workshops and trainings worldwide since 2002. His Liquid Flow style blends classical roots with modern, intuitive movement - fluid, expressive and inspired by teachers like Shiva Rea, Richard Freeman and Dharma Mitra. Known as the "Flying Nomad," Simon brings a spirit of freedom and artistry to every practice.

WHAT ELSE TO DO IN BASEL
We love coffee at bhoch3, lunch at Markthalle and an evening stroll along the river to have a cold or hot beverage at a Buvette. There are alternative and open-minded open spaces like the Landestelle, to eat, drink and connect with people.
Need more nature? You can find nature in a quite a few places around town with free entry, including the Botanical Gardens, the river Rhein, the Lange Erlen Animal Park, and Grün80 Park.
